500+ Emergency Kit Backpacks Sold In Laguna Beach
Recently, the Laguna Beach specific emergency packs were released to the public, and it's become the Christmas gift of the season.

LAGUNA BEACH, CA — Don't be left out this holiday, Laguna Beach police say. The city specific emergency pack that would fit so nicely under that tree is still available.
Since the launch of the emergency backpack campaign in late November, over 502 backpacks have been purchased! “We’ve had a strong response from the community in support of the City’s Emergency Backpack initiative,” said Jordan Villwock, Emergency Operations Coordinator. “We sold out of backpacks the first week of the campaign, and since then demand has been steady. Some residents are even ordering them as Christmas gifts.”
The kit includes the following: AM/FM hand crank radio with flashlight and cell phone charger, 4-in-1 gas and water utility shut off tool, glow sticks, bio-hazard bags, nitrile gloves, N95 mask, 54-piece first aid kit, duct tape, emergency poncho, solar blanket, and a personal hygiene kit.

Additionally, the kit contains emergency plan templates and disaster-specific information. Each red backpack features an official City of Laguna Beach Seal.
Purchase the Laguna Beach-specific Emergency Kit Backpack for $50.00 on the City’s website via https://bit.ly/2DlnFGy or in person at the Community and Susi Q Center, 380 3rd Street during normal business hours. No profits are being made from the sale of this backpack, the city said.
